Intermediate Fly Tying Class
Class: Steelhead Flies
Date/Time: September 25th, 2010, 2:00 pm – 4:00 pm
Maximum Size: 8
Instructor: Ian Anderson
Cost: $10.00
Synopsis of Class
It is time once again where certain fisherman get that strange twitch in the corner of their eye. A time of year when otherwise normal men and women turn into steelheading fanatics.  The steelhead start to run in from the great lakes and the fisherman start to run to the rivers.  Everyone has a favorite pattern.  The ones you will tie up in this class are some tried and true patterns and some are new to fly fishing.  All are very productive.   The four that will be taught in this class are simple patterns that with slight color and material changes can be adapted to any situation.
